2024 Collaborative R&D Lead participant

Novel mRNA-based cell therapy for childhood brain cancer

1 Aug 2024 to 31 Jan 2026

Awarded
£606,702
Total cost £866,717

Adoptive cell therapy is a treatment of patients using their own, modified immune cells. It involves harvesting T cells - the immune cells that normally recognise and eliminate pathogens - from the patient's blood, reprogramming them to identify cancer cells and re-introducing the newly modified cells back into the patient to destroy tumours.
